However, by consulting a fertility expert, you can learn that it is essentially triggered by two hormones released in the body as one ovulates, namely the Luteinizing hormone and the surge of estrogen.

If you are overly concerned, there are ways you can reduce bloating during or after your ovulation. You can build a habit of regular exercise that can help in combating bloating. Nothing too strenuous, but keeping the body active is one way to make sure that you are capable of dealing with bloating. You also need to keep an eye on what you are eating and whether your diet is rich in potassium and magnesium. Your body tends to retain water and sodium in the absence of potassium and magnesium. Some healthy food options you can incorporate into your diet are ananas, kale, tomatoes, sweet potatoes, spinach, and avocados.
